Thanatosian posted:The protections granted to you as an LLC if you're operating as a sole proprietorship are minimal, especially if you don't have any assets to shield, and the additional costs of operating as an LLC can be pretty high. LLCs don't exist in Canada anyway. OP, just start doing and don't worry about the legal or tax stuff. Keep your receipts for business expenses, and you don't need to charge GST until you reach a certain amount of sales. When you do actually become profitable (and owe taxes), that's when you can start hiring an accountant and figuring out how to structure your business. Now's a good time to start up an etsy shop or whatever and take advantage of the weak Canadian Dollar.
